Specifications include, but are not limited to: The primary role of the Council is to “assure that individuals with developmental disabilities and their families have access to culturally competent services, supports, and other assistance and opportunities to promote independence, productivity, and integration and inclusion in the community”. The Council promotes, through systemic change, capacity-building and advocacy, a consumer and family-centered comprehensive system and coordinated array of services, supports and other assistance for individuals with developmental disabilities and their families. The Council recognizes that individuals with developmental disabilities and their families have capabilities and personal goals that should be recognized and encouraged, and any assistance to such individuals should be provided in an individualized manner, consistent with the unique abilities of the individual.
